concretizer: handle variant defaults with optimization

- Instead of using default logic, handle variant defaults by minimizing
  the number of non-default variants in the solution.

- This actually seems to be pretty fast, and it fixes the long-standing
  issue that writing this:

      spack install hdf5 ^mpich

  will fail if you don't specify hdf5+mpi.  With optimization and
  allowing enums to be enumerated, the solver seems to be able to quickly
  discover that +mpi is the only way hdf5 can depend on mpich, and it
  forces the switch to be thrown.
